Inclusions company invests in packaging line

Inclusions specialist Pecan Deluxe Candy (Europe) has made a significant investment in a new, bespoke packaging line that will increase the company’s bagging capability by up to 400%. Pacepacker bagging line makes the grade

For just over a decade, Pacepacker Services’ Total Bag Control (TBC) bagging system installed at Pasta Foods has adapted to meet the company’s changing needs and has continued to provide reliable, dust-free operation.
